Transaction 8950e92b84ace6b2db262b97628306e09ce0219f662041d62ba81fb16ba30633
1 Input
1 Output
-
8950e92b84ace6b2db262b97628306e09ce0219f662041d62ba81fb16ba30633:0
- value
- 1050906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c42776814bd3873a05bd22959d4ba9798e9bbf2 OP_EQUAL
- address
- 3LK3Pr1ZJ3p1noB6ygaraW5FEbKiRd4KVw